优化WordPress网站性能:从页面加载到用户体验的完整指南

2 分钟阅读
2026-03-25
2026-06-03
1,948
通过下方链接进行购物时,您无需支付额外费用,我就能获得佣金。.

在競爭激烈的網際網路環境中,一個載入迅速、響應靈敏的 WordPress 網站不僅是良好使用者體驗的基石,更是 SEO 排名和轉化率的關鍵影響因素。頁面延遲每增加一秒,都可能導致訪客流失和商業機會的錯失。因此,對網站效能進行系統性最佳化,不再是可選項,而是每個網站管理者的必修課。

本文將深入探討從伺服器配置到前端程式碼的完整效能最佳化鏈條,旨在為您提供一套可立即實操的解決方案。

核心效能指標與診斷工具

在開始最佳化之前,我們必須明確目標和衡量標準。現代 Web 效能評估主要圍繞使用者體驗的核心指標展開。

推荐阅读 优化WordPress网站速度的终极指南:从加载缓慢到瞬间打开的实用策略

理解關鍵效能指標

最重要的幾項指標包括:最大內容繪製,用於衡量視覺載入速度;首次輸入延遲,用於衡量互動響應性;累積佈局偏移,用於衡量視覺穩定性。這三者共同構成了Google頁面體驗的核心排名因素。此外,首位元組時間與完全載入時間等傳統指標同樣具有重要參考價值。

UltaHost WordPress 主機
30天退款保證,無限頻寬與資料庫,免費的 DDoS 防護,購買3年優惠50%

實用的診斷工具推薦

工欲善其事,必先利其器。推薦使用以下工具進行全方位診斷:Google PageSpeed Insights 提供基於實驗室資料和真實使用者資料的全面報告;GTmetrix 則提供詳細的瀑布流分析和最佳化建議;對於本地開發環境,Lighthouse 整合在 Chrome 開發者工具中,可以隨時進行審計。此外,Query Monitor 外掛能深入剖析 WordPress 後臺的 PHP 查詢與鉤子執行情況。

透過這些工具生成的報告,您可以精準定位效能瓶頸,例如緩慢的伺服器響應、過大的圖片資源或是堵塞渲染的 JavaScript 檔案。

优化服务器和托管环境

網站效能的底層基礎是伺服器。一個配置不當的託管環境會讓所有前端最佳化事倍功半。

選擇與配置高效能主機

首先,應優先考慮專為 WordPress 最佳化的託管服務,這些服務通常預裝了物件快取、最新的 PHP 版本和 HTTP/2 支援。對於有一定流量規模的網站,虛擬私有伺服器或雲主機能提供更強的控制力和資源保障。務必確保伺服器地理位置靠近您的目標使用者群體,以降低網路延遲。

推荐阅读 《WordPress优化终极指南:20个提升网站速度与性能的实用技巧》

实施高效的缓存策略

快取是提升速度最有效的手段之一。在伺服器層面,應啟用操作碼快取如 OPCache 來加速 PHP 執行。對於動態內容,物件快取 Memcached 或 Redis)能與 WordPress 外掛協同工作,極大地降低資料庫查詢負載。

在 WordPress 端,可以使用功能强大的缓存插件,如 WP Rocket 或 W3 Total Cache。这些插件可以生成静态 HTML 文件,实现页面级缓存。在进行配置时,请确保为登录用户和购物车页面设置缓存排除规则,并为静态资源设置较长的过期头。

以下是一个示例,通过 .htaccess 檔案為圖片和 CSS/JS 設定瀏覽器快取:

hostng.com 共享主机
高效能,配备 AMD EPYC CPU、NVMe SSD 存储和 LiteSpeed,全天候 24 小时专业内部支持,先进的安全措施包括 SSL、暴力破解、恶意软件和 DDoS 防护,节省高达 731 TB/月的带宽成本。
# 启用 expires 缓存
<IfModule mod_expires.c>
ExpiresActive On
ExpiresByType image/jpg “access plus 1 year”
ExpiresByType image/jpeg “access plus 1 year”
ExpiresByType image/gif “access plus 1 year”
ExpiresByType image/png “access plus 1 year”
ExpiresByType text/css “access plus 1 month”
ExpiresByType application/javascript “access plus 1 month”
</IfModule>

主題與外掛效能調優

WordPress 的灵活性和性能有时会相互矛盾。低质量的主题和插件是导致网站运行缓慢、内容臃肿的主要原因。

精選與評估程式碼質量

在選擇主題和外掛時,務必進行效能評估。優先選擇官方目錄中評分高、更新頻繁、支援響應式的產品。避免使用功能過於龐雜的“瑞士軍刀”型主題,這類主題往往載入了大量您用不到的指令碼和樣式。可以使用前文提到的診斷工具,在安裝新外掛前後分別測試,觀察其對效能指標的影響。

管理資料庫與後臺程序

長期執行的網站,資料庫中會積累大量修訂版本、草稿、垃圾評論等冗餘資料,影響查詢效率。定期使用外掛如 WP-Optimize 進行清理最佳化。同時,審查並禁用不必要的 WordPress 心跳API,該功能用於實時更新,但可能增加伺服器負擔。可以在 wp-config.php 添加以下代码来降低其出现频率:

推荐阅读 终极WordPress优化指南:提升网站性能与SEO排名的完整策略

define( ‘WP_HEARTBEAT_INTERVAL’, 120 ); // 将频率设置为120秒

對於預定釋出文章的任務,如果您的託管環境不支援可靠的 Cron 服務,考慮使用伺服器級的 Cron 來替代 WordPress 的偽 Cron,方法是在 wp-config.php 游戏设定:define(‘DISABLE_WP_CRON’, true);然后,您可以在服务器面板中设置定时任务访问权限。 wp-cron.php

前端資源與載入過程最佳化

當用戶請求您的網站時,瀏覽器需要下載和解析 HTML、CSS、JavaScript、圖片等資源。最佳化這個載入過程能帶來最直觀的速度提升。

InterServer 共享主机
虚拟主机的月费为1TB+5TB,价格为2.50美元。首月优惠价为1TB+5TB,价格为0.1美元。优惠码为"tryinterserver"。平台提供461个云应用脚本,一键安装便捷。

圖片與媒體資源最佳化

圖片通常是頁面體積的最大組成部分。首先,確保所有圖片都經過壓縮。可以使用外掛如 ShortPixel 或 Imagify 進行自動壓縮,或在上傳前手動使用工具處理。其次,使用現代格式如 WebP,它能提供更好的壓縮率。最後,實施懶載入技術,讓首屏外的圖片僅在使用者滾動到其附近時才開始載入。WordPress 5.5 及以上版本已內建了原生的圖片懶載入支援。

指令碼與樣式表的智慧控制

合併、壓縮 CSS 和 JavaScript 檔案可以減少 HTTP 請求數量。但更關鍵的是,要消除渲染阻塞資源。將非關鍵的 CSS 進行“非同步載入”,並將 JavaScript 標記為 async 或者 defer这可以防止它们阻塞页面的初始渲染。许多性能插件都提供了相关的选项。

對於由外掛載入到全站的、但某些頁面並不需要的指令碼,可以使用如 Asset CleanUp 這樣的外掛進行按頁面解除安裝。此外,將 Google 字型等第三方資源本地化或非同步載入,也能避免因外部伺服器延遲而造成的阻塞。

實施關鍵路徑渲染最佳化

核心 Web 字型會導致文字渲染延遲。使用 font-display: swap; CSS 属性可以确保文本立即使用替代字体显示,并在网络字体加载完成后进行替换。同时,内联首屏渲染所需的关键 CSS 会直接嵌入到 HTML 代码中。 部分,能讓瀏覽器無需等待外部 CSS 檔案即可開始渲染可視內容。

总结

优化WordPress网站性能是一项涉及服务器、应用程序、数据库和前端资源的系统工程,没有一劳永逸的“灵丹妙药”。最佳实践是采取持续改进的策略:从选择可靠的主机开始,实施多层缓存,谨慎选择并定期审核主题和插件,最后对前端资源进行精细化的加载控制。

定期使用效能診斷工具進行檢測,將核心 Web 指標納入日常監控範圍。每一次主題更新、外掛安裝或內容新增後,都重新評估效能影響。記住,最佳化的終極目標是為使用者提供快速、流暢且愉悅的訪問體驗,而這最終將轉化為更好的搜尋引擎排名、更高的使用者參與度與商業成功。

常见问题解答(FAQ)

使用免費快取外掛能否達到專業外掛效果

免費快取外掛,如 WP Super Cache,可以顯著提升網站速度,特別是在靜態頁面快取方面。它們能有效減少伺服器負載並加快頁面傳遞。

然而,專業付費外掛如 WP Rocket 通常提供更全面、一體化的解決方案。它們除了基礎快取,還集成了資料庫最佳化、心跳控制、預載入、延遲載入、CDN 整合等高階功能,且配置更為簡單直觀。對於追求極致效能和無須複雜技術配置的使用者,投資專業外掛往往能獲得更高的投入產出比。

網站啟用CDN後速度反而變慢的原因

這種情況可能由幾個原因導致。最常見的是 CDN 節點配置問題,例如快取規則設定不當,導致動態內容被錯誤快取,或靜態資源沒有成功快取。其次,DNS 解析時間可能因 CDN 引入的額外 CNAME 記錄而增加。

另一個可能的原因是“回源”速度慢。如果您的源伺服器本身響應就很慢,那麼 CDN 首次從源站拉取資源時也會很慢,直到資源在 CDN 節點快取後,後續訪問才會提速。建議檢查 CDN 後臺的快取命中率報告,並確保源伺服器效能本身已得到最佳化。

如何檢測具體哪個外掛拖慢了網站速度

最有效的方法是進行隔離測試。首先,在網站前臺和後臺頁面執行一次效能檢測,記錄核心指標。然後,進入 WordPress 後臺,暫時停用所有外掛。

隨後,逐一重新啟用您懷疑可能對效能影響較大的外掛,每啟用一個,便重新測試一次網站前臺的關鍵頁面。透過對比每次啟用外掛前後的效能報告資料變化,可以清晰地定位導致效能下降的具體外掛。外掛 Query Monitor 也能在後臺直接顯示每個外掛載入的指令碼、樣式及其執行時間,是診斷問題的強大工具。

最佳化後網站速度仍不理想該怎麼辦

如果經過系統最佳化後,速度提升仍不達預期,需要進行更深層次的排查。請複查基礎環節:您的虛擬主機資源是否充足?是否正在使用共享主機上被過度銷售的方案?資料庫是否過於龐大且未最佳化?

檢查主題的程式碼質量,考慮切換到如 Astra、GeneratePress 等以輕量和速度著稱的框架。審視網站是否包含了過多來自第三方域名的請求。最後,考慮聘請專業開發人員進行程式碼級審計,可能存在著難以透過外掛解決的、深層次的程式碼效率問題或錯誤的查詢。